Introduction to DNT2Mi-fp DN0445814 © Nokia Corporation 9 (60) Issue 2-0 en Nokia Proprietary and Confidential 2 Introduction to DNT2Mi-fp Nokia DNT2Mi-fp is a fixed port data access network terminal intended forcustomer premises. It provides a two-wire or four-wire SHDSL line interface(ITU-T G.991....

Management DN0445814 © Nokia Corporation 23 (60) Issue 2-0 en Nokia Proprietary and Confidential 5 Management The Local Management Interface (LMI) is located at the rear panel (see Figure12). The interface is used to manage DNT2Mi-fp with Service Terminal (V.11)and Macro Service Terminal Emulator (t...

Q1 management bus Up to 32 DNT2Mi-fp units can be connected to the same Q1 bus of V.11-type viaa local management interface. DNT2Mi-fp - - - Tx Rx Tx Rx Tx Rx Tx Rx DNT2Mi-fp DIP-switch DSL Li...
